Responsibilities:
- Provide direct personal care to residents and patients, including bathing, grooming, dressing, and oral hygiene in LTC and rehabilitation settings
- Assist patients with ambulation, transfers, and mobility exercises under the supervision of licensed nursing staff and physical therapists
- Monitor and accurately document vital signs including blood pressure, pulse, temperature, and respiratory rate and report changes to the charge nurse
- Support patients with meals and nutritional intake, including feeding assistance and hydration monitoring in accordance with care plans
- Respond promptly to call lights and patient requests, ensuring a safe, dignified, and respectful care environment at all times
- Assist rehabilitation patients with prescribed exercise programs and therapeutic activities as directed by the supervising clinical team
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ized patient environment by performing routine room tidying, linen changes, and infection control practices
- Observe and report changes in patient physical condition, behavior, or emotional status to the nursing team to facilitate timely interventions
- Document care activities accurately in electronic health records or paper charting systems in compliance with California state and facility requirements
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ary healthcare teams including nurses, therapists, and social workers to support individualized patient care plans
Qualifications & Requirements for CNA Candidates in San Francisco
- Current and active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) certification in the state of California, in good standing with the California Department of Public Health (CDPH) Aide and Technician Certification Section (ATCS)
- Minimum of a high school diploma or GED equivalent
- Current CPR and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from an accredited provider such as the American Heart Association or American Red Cross
- Prior experience in a long-term care, skilled nursing facility, or rehabilitation setting preferred but not required for entry-level candidates
- Ability to safely perform patient lifts, transfers, and physical care tasks, with capacity to stand, walk, and remain active for extended shift durations
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to work compassionately with elderly, post-surgical, and rehabilitation patient populations
- Demonstrated reliability, professionalism, and adherence to HIPAA privacy standards and California healthcare compliance regulations
- Willingness to work flexible shifts including days, evenings, nights, and weekends in accordance with temporary staffing assignment needs
